            The Tree Top Canopy Tour at the Honeysuckle Hill Farm Zip Line is composed of three sky towers, sky bridges, and eight zip lines. The total span of the adventure goes over roughly a mile of the forest.

            Scenic nature cruises in the Ashland City area are headed mostly by Blue Heron Cruises. Guests climb aboard the boat named the Blue Heron and are then taken through 30,000 acres of the wildlife refuge.

            Consisting of three separate trails, Beaman Park Hiking Trails offers five miles of hiking through wooded and hilly terrain and along a creek. It has a portable restroom, three trailheads, wildflowers and areas suitable for picnics.

            One of the revived drive-in theatres in Dickson, Tennessee, the Broadway Drive-in Movie Theater features a solo screen with a single feature each weekend on Friday, Saturday and Sunday. Movies begin a dusk with children under 3 admitted free.

            The Narrows of the Harpeth State Park covers a 40 mile linear stretch along the Harpeth River. Natural, archaeological, and historic sites and nine access points are covered by the park and allow for hiking and canoeing.
